LFG CON is San Diego's dedicated tabletop gaming convention, held annually at the San Diego Convention Center for a full weekend of board games, role-playing games, miniature wargames, card games, and the social culture that defines tabletop gaming as a hobby. The 2027 edition continues the convention's growth into one of the most significant tabletop events in the Western United States. LFG CON's format is built around play rather than commerce: open gaming library with thousands of titles available to borrow and play at any of the convention's gaming tables, organized play events for competitive board games and RPG systems, publisher-run demos of upcoming and new releases, and the convention's signature "Find a Game" board where attendees post what they want to play and find other players spontaneously. The San Diego Convention Center's gaming hall provides enough space for the event's library, open gaming tables, and organized events to run simultaneously without the cramped conditions that smaller gaming conventions produce at capacity. The Gaslamp Quarter's proximity means meals and evening social gatherings extend the convention day well beyond the gaming hall's closing hours. The SDCC is at 111 W Harbor Dr in downtown San Diego. Trolley accessible, multiple parking structures nearby. Weekend badges and single-day options available through the LFG CON website. The gaming library check-out system runs on a first-come basis — popular titles can be signed out for 2-hour sessions throughout the day.

For nine days in March, Austin becomes the place where the music industry, the film industry, and the technology industry all arrive at the same time and try to find the same parties. SXSW is not a single event. It is a city-sized festival. The Music Conference alone hosts thousands of acts across hundreds of venues — dive bars, converted warehouses, the Austin Convention Center, the open air of Auditorium Shores. Simultaneously, the Film & TV Festival premieres features and series that go on to win Oscars and Emmys. The Interactive and Emerging Technology conference hosts the conversations that define how the industry thinks about what comes next. These three things happen at the same time, in the same zip code. The cross-pollination is not incidental to SXSW — it is the product. The person who sees a breakthrough band at midnight and a groundbreaking documentary at noon and stumbles into a startup pitch at 3pm is not having three separate experiences. They are having the SXSW experience. If you have ever felt like the interesting version of American culture is happening somewhere you're not, SXSW is the coordinates. The festival rewards the person who arrives with no fixed agenda and the flexibility to follow what's interesting. It punishes the person who over-plans and misses the spontaneous set that becomes the most-discussed performance of the year. The unofficial parties and free shows are as important as the official programming — sometimes more. Austin in March is warm but unpredictable — layers are essential, comfortable shoes are mandatory. SXSW runs on a badge system: the Platinum badge accesses everything; the Music badge covers all official showcases. Unofficial events are free and run parallel throughout the city, often featuring the most interesting programming. Book accommodation six to twelve months out — Austin fills completely. The Convention Center is the official hub, but the real SXSW happens on 6th Street, Red River, and in the South Congress corridor. WonderCon returns to the Anaheim Convention Center for its 2027 edition, March 26–28. WonderCon is operated by Comic-Con International — the same organization behind San Diego Comic-Con — and has grown into one of the premier pop culture conventions in the Western United States, drawing over 60,000 attendees annually. WonderCon covers comics, sci-fi, fantasy, animation, film, television, gaming, and cosplay with a programming slate that runs all three days across multiple halls. The masquerade cosplay competition on Saturday night is a flagship event. Publisher booths, artist alley, exclusive merchandise, and preview screenings fill the convention floor. Unlike SDCC, WonderCon remains more accessible — badges are easier to acquire and the convention floor is navigable without the overwhelming scale of San Diego. This makes it the preferred entry point for families and first-time convention attendees, while still delivering the panel access and guest signings that attract serious fans. The Anaheim Convention Center is located adjacent to Disneyland, with easy access from I-5 and I-405. The Anaheim Regional Transportation Intermodal Center (ARTIC) connects to the convention area via shuttle during the event. Multiple hotels within walking distance. Anime Expo 2027 returns to the Los Angeles Convention Center over the Fourth of July weekend, marking another year of what has become the largest anime convention in North America. AX draws over 100,000 attendees annually to experience the full spectrum of Japanese animation, manga, gaming, music, and pop culture in one of the most densely packed convention weekends in the world. The LACC footprint spans multiple halls and the adjacent JW Marriott and Ritz-Carlton hotels, hosting industry panels, world premiere announcements, screening rooms, an exhibit hall with hundreds of vendors, autograph sessions with voice actors and anime composers, and concerts and live performances that sell out weeks in advance. Industry guests from major animation studios in Japan make AX their primary North American announcement platform — if a major sequel, adaptation, or licensing deal is going to be revealed, AX is often where it happens first. For fans of specific series, the AX floor is where you find rare imported merchandise, exclusive collaboration products, and limited-run items that do not appear anywhere else. For casual anime watchers, the convention is a crash course in the depth and breadth of the community surrounding the medium. Badge types range from Premier Fan badges (early access, priority room entry) to general admission single-day passes. The convention runs Thursday through Sunday over Independence Day weekend. Plan for crowds and book hotels inside the connected hotel corridor months in advance for the most convenient experience.

San Diego Comic-Con International returns for 2027, and Preview Night on Wednesday July 21 is where the convention truly begins for badge holders. Preview Night offers four to five hours of exclusive convention floor access before the general public arrives Thursday — the chance to see the floor before it fills, acquire exclusive merchandise before it sells out, and experience the convention at a pace that the full three public days rarely allow. SDCC Preview Night badges are the most coveted ticket in the convention. They are only available to badge holders who have purchased a full convention package or a Preview Night standalone badge in the registration lottery. The lottery runs months in advance through Comic-Con's online badge system — sign up for the Member ID program now if you plan to participate. The convention floor spans the San Diego Convention Center's entire footprint — over 460,000 square feet of exhibits, publisher booths, studio installations, and exclusive merchandise. The 2027 Preview Night badge grants access starting at 6 PM and running until close, roughly four hours of unimpeded access before Thursday's general opening. San Diego Convention Center is located at 111 W Harbor Dr, directly accessible from the Gaslamp Quarter and the downtown waterfront. The convention center connects to the Gaslamp via the trolley system. Hotel room blocks in the SDCC room block lottery fill during the spring — if you have a badge, register for the hotel lottery immediately.

San Diego Comic-Con 2027 opens its first full public day on Thursday July 22, launching what is widely considered the most important pop culture event on the annual calendar. Thursday at SDCC is the sleeper day — thinner crowds than Friday or Saturday, Hall H programming already in full swing, and an energy in the convention center that the weekend days, for all their spectacle, rarely match. Hall H on Thursday is where studios frequently schedule panels intended to be surprise announcements — the logic being that a Thursday panel lands at the ideal point in the news cycle to build weekend buzz. Film studios, streaming platforms, game publishers, and comic book publishers all compete for time in Hall H and Ballroom 20. The convention floor is open all day with access to exhibitors, publishers, artist alley, the exclusive merchandise area, and the entire range of Comic-Con programming. Thursday badges give access to all programming rooms, screenings, and exhibits. Signing schedules with creators in Artist Alley run throughout the day. The surrounding Gaslamp Quarter blocks fill with satellite activations, off-site experiences, and screenings from studios that didn't secure convention space but still want to be part of Comic-Con week. Many of these are free with badge scan or open to the public. San Diego's hotel infrastructure handles the convention smoothly; the city has been doing this for decades.
